The anticipation of facing Guatemala in the semifinals brings to mind a famous story about a team talk given by legendary coach Sir Alex Ferguson to Manchester United before a match against Tottenham. The Red Devils were overwhelming favorites, and Ferguson’s simple three-word message to his players was, “Lads, it’s Tottenham.” This anecdote, now a meme in football circles, serves as a reminder that sometimes, facing a perceived weaker opponent requires focus and determination.
As the USMNT prepares to take on Guatemala, they understand the importance of not underestimating their opponents. While Guatemala may not be considered a powerhouse in international football, their recent victory over tournament co-favorite Canada demonstrates their ability to compete at a high level. The USMNT must approach the match with respect and a determination to secure a win.
